Winner of two Academy Awards®, for Best Actor in a Leading Role (Sean Penn) and Best Actor in a Supporting Role (Tim Robbins), Clint Eastwood's eagerly anticipated, haunting masterpiece Mystic River will be released on DVD by Warner Home Video on 7th June 2004. The film was nominated for 4 BAFTA Awards and was winner of the London Critics Circle Film Awards' Actor of the Year (Sean Penn) and Director of the Year (Clint Eastwood).

Drawing together "A fantasy line-up of modern cinema" - Esquire, Clint Eastwood brings his own Academy Award® winning (Unforgiven) directing style to this complex, emotional thriller based on the best-selling novel by Dennis Lehane} and adapted for the screen by Brian Helgeland (L.A. Confidential). Sean Penn leads an all star cast in a moving performance as a father mourning the loss of his murdered daughter. Penn's career spans previous Academy Award® nominated roles in Dead Man Walking, I Am Sam and Sweet and Lowdown. Tim Robbins, an actor of considerable power (The Shawshank Redemption, The Player) has a history with Penn having been Academy Award® nominated for directing him in Dead Man Walking.

Joining Penn and Robbins are Academy Award® winner }Marcia Gay Harden (Pollock), who was nominated as Best Actress in a Supporting Role for Mystic River, Kevin Bacon (Sleepers), Laurence Fishburne (The Matrix trilogy) and Laura Linney (The Truman Show). Synopsis

When they were kids growing up together in a rough section of Boston, Jimmy Markum (Sean Penn), Dave Boyle (Tim Robbins) and Sean Devine (Kevin Bacon) spent their days playing stickball on the street. Nothing much ever happened in their neighbourhood. That is, until Dave was forced to take the ride that would change all of their lives forever.

Twenty-five years later, the three find themselves thrust back together by another life altering event - the murder of Jimmy's 19-year-old daughter. Now a cop, Sean is assigned to the case and he and his partner (Laurence Fishburne) are charged with unravelling the seemingly senseless crime. They must also stay one step ahead of Jimmy, a man driven by an all-consuming rage to find his daughter's killer. As the investigation tightens around these three friends, an ominous story unfolds that revolves around friendship, family and innocence lost too soon.
